Description
Description: See numbered notes: 9, 26, and 27. NSN 2510-01-175-7219, Frame section, structural, vehicular being bought in accordance with Army (19207) drawing 12338223 and all related data. This part requires a contractor First Article Test (FAT). The total quantity required is 3800 each to be shipped to (W25G1U) New Cumberland, PA 17070-5000. The solicitation also includes a 50% option for up to 1900 each which may or may not be exercised.. This solicitation is an RFP and will be available on the Internet at http://www.dibbs.bsm.dla.mil/rfp after the issue date of 9/28/07, hard copies of this solicitation are not available. Technical drawings/bid sets are available after the above issue date via e-mail to cddwgs@dscc.dla.mil or via voice mail to our 24-hour request line at 614-692-2344. Requests should include the RFP number, opening/closing date, NSN, purchase Request Number, buyer?s name and your complete name and address. FEDERAL, MILITARY AND COMMERCIAL SPECIFICATIONS CANNOT BE PROVIDED BY DSCC. This solicitation is set-aside 100% for small HUBZone business concerns. While price may be a significant factor in the evaluation of offers, the final award decision will be based upon a combination of price, past performance, and delivery. The required delivery is 1000 each in 60 days plus 1000 each every 30 days until complete with FAT waived and 1000 each in 180 days plus 1000 every 30 days until complete with FAT required.
